How much do sandstone statues weigh?

The weight of a sandstone statue will depend on the size of the statue. Larger statues will weigh more than smaller statues. Sandstone generally weighs 150 pounds per cubic foot.


What is the weight of sandstone?

The weight of sandstone can vary depending on its density, composition, and size. On average, sandstone has a density of about 2.2-2.5 grams per cubic centimeter. A cubic meter of sandstone can weigh between 2,200 to 2,500 kilograms.

What rock is harder than sandstone?

Granite is typically harder than sandstone. Granite is an igneous rock that forms from the cooling of molten magma, making it more dense and resistant to abrasion compared to sandstone, which is a sedimentary rock.


What is sandstone characteristics?

Sandstone is much like compressed sand. It is soft and the granules will easily come off and reform sand. It is often colorful and can have many layers.
